# Env file — Cartwheel dispatch, driver-assignment heuristic
# Scope: staging only. Do not promote to prod.
# The heuristic weights (proximity, shift balance, refusal rate) are tuned
# for the Velmont pilot region and will misbehave elsewhere.
# Review notes: heuristic service runs unprivileged; it reads weights
# read-only from the tuning store and writes nothing back.
# Only one sensitive value exists in this file: the tuning-store access
# credential, consumed at boot and never logged.
# That credential is set on the following line.

secret setting of faduf-bahop: LEDGER_TOKEN8=c3b363be

Subject: Handover — FieldMapper offline release duties

Hi Orla,

Taking care to be thorough here since you're also reviewing the branch: the offline-mode queue flush must land before the 2.9 tag, and the conflict-resolution tests need a clean pass twice. Everything else is documented in the runbook. For signing the release artifact, use the key below.

release key, hadug-kawef: bky13_mPGeFZeR1GZ1G

Welcome to the team. The Routeloom service assigns drivers to pickups using a weighted scoring heuristic, and nearly every tunable lives in the environment rather than in code. `ROUTELOOM_MAX_RADIUS_KM` caps the search area, `ROUTELOOM_DECAY_FACTOR` controls how quickly idle-time weighting grows, and `ROUTELOOM_REBALANCE_SECS` sets how often scores are recomputed. All of these are safe to experiment with in the sandbox tier. The service also authenticates to the dispatch gateway using a credential defined on the next line of the env file.

sealed setting: COURIER_KEY13=1033dd92e5af1